About the role
The position to which you are applying is represented by a collective bargaining unit, Massachusetts Nurses Association. Mass General Brigham’s Home Hospital is transforming acute care by bringing hospital-level services directly into the home. As a Virtual Registered Nurse (VRN), you will deliver high-quality, patient-centered care using advanced technology, remote patient monitoring, and a collaborative team-based model.
Responsibilities
- Performs and documents nursing process, assessment, diagnosis, planning, implementation, and evaluation of patients receiving care remotely, in their defined home.
- Performs virtual care, patient assessment, remote patient monitoring (as ordered) and works with the clinical care team to provide care, trend data, and respond accordingly.
- Provides protocol driven assessments, care coordination and intervenes as appropriate and defined by MGB Healthcare at Home protocols.
- Exhibits sound clinical decision making and critical thinking skills for a diverse patient population.
- Maintains and practices in accordance with nursing guidelines, as well as institutional, local, and state regulations.
- Performs admissions, discharges, and episodic visits within MGB Home Hospital, through high quality virtual patient-centered care.
- Serves as a role model for professional nursing practice.
- Utilizes nursing knowledge to identify, prevent and or solve complex acute and/or recurring patient care problems.
- Supports research efforts to advance knowledge and promote evidence-based practice.
- Completes timely documentation for all nursing care in Epic.
- Answers, directs, and provides follow up on incoming clinical patient concerns.
Qualifications
- Graduation from an accredited school of nursing. BSN preferred.
- BLS
- Current license to practice as a Registered Nurse in Massachusetts.
- At least 3 years of Emergency Department experience required.
- Telemetry experience preferred.
- Telehealth and remote patient monitoring experience preferred.
- Telephone triage experience preferred.
- Proficiency with Epic, Microsoft Outlook, Microsoft Teams, and other web-based platforms preferred.
- Excellent communication, interpersonal, and organizational skills required.
- Experience working in a start-up environment and/or willingness to adapt to continuous change encouraged.
